Muli Road railway station is a railway station on the Western Railway network in the state of Gujarat, India.[1][2] Muli Road railway station is 22 km far away from Surendranagar railway station. Three Passenger and an Express trains halt here.[3][4]
Nearby stations[edit]
Ramparda is the nearest railway station towards Wankaner Junction, whereas Digsar is the nearest railway station towards Surendranagar Junction.
